Question 1173838: An engineer traveled 170 mi by car and then an additional 645 mi by plane. The rate of the plane was three times the rate of the car. The total trip took 7 h. Find the rate of the car.

            SPEED        TIME              DISTANCE

CAR           c          170/c               170

PLANE        3c          645/(3c)            645

TOTAL                      7
